Depending on the process used, the methane content control indicators are also different. We use Ende furnace, and methane is generally 15-17%. High methane content is equivalent to increasing the inert gas in the synthesis gas, which will reduce ammonia production. Therefore, try to control it at the lowest limit, which will help increase ammonia production.

Methane is an inert gas in the production of synthetic ammonia. It does not poison the catalyst and does not participate in the reaction. However, if methane is not removed in time and gradually accumulates in the system, it will reduce the partial pressure of hydrogen and nitrogen and reduce the ammonia synthesis rate. Our factory controls it to 10-15%.
